Make Spiritborn polearms equipable for Barbarians too
As with other items - changing the aspect unique to a class and the main attribute affix makes it possible to equip all other items on different classes, but this does not work with polearms. Even in the possible rolls window it shows that it is possible to roll strength, but instead it rolls dexterity, which is not even in the possible affixes list.
